1 x double bedroom
2 x bathroom
1 x kitchen
1 x dining/living room
2 x storage room (basement)
There is a study area in the upstairs hallway (not a separate room); one could put a tiny single bedroom in place of that, or in the basement. Currently the basement is only a storage space.
One could also cut off a second 2x1 toilet from the landing that leads to the garden (I didn't do that since I'd play the house from the other direction, so that the chimney would block the view of that toilet).
Prices given below (F = Furnished; U = Unfurnished) are when placed on a regular 20x30 lot.
Built on the smallest lot I have (16x18), so it can be rotated in any direction on every other lot. Playable from several angles; two or three sides of the house would work as a street side.

Install Instructions
1. Click the file listed on the Files tab to download the file to your computer.
2. Extract the zip, rar, or 7z file.
2. Select the .sims3pack file you got from extracting.
3. Cut and paste it into your Documents\Electronic Arts\The Sims 3\Downloads folder. If you do not have this folder yet, it is recommended that you open the game and then close it again so that this folder will be automatically created. Then you can place the .sims3pack into your Downloads folder.
5. Load the game's Launcher, and click on the Downloads tab. Select the house icon, find the lot in the list, and tick the box next to it. Then press the Install button below the list.
6. Wait for the installer to load, and it will install the lot to the game. You will get a message letting you know when it's done.
7. Run the game, and find your lot in Edit Town, in the premade lots bin.
Extracting from RAR, ZIP, or 7z: You will need a special program for this. For Windows, we recommend 7-Zip and for Mac OSX, we recommend Keka. Both are free and safe to use.
